The television channel GRP war will reach a new high with the Telugu states of Andhra Pradesh and Telangana set to enter the elections mood very soon.
In this context, the latest GRP of the leading Telugu news channels is here and here’s a look into the same.
In Hyderabad, TV5 is surprisingly is in the number 1 position with a whopping 86 GRP in the 18th week(most recent) of 2023. The channel is evidently performing pretty well in Hyderabad as the Telugu states head for elections.
ABN has 61 GRP which is again a notable tally. In comparison, YCP’s mouthpiece Sakshi has a mere 10 GRP. The difference is staggering here and it shows the plight of YCP’s Sakshi media.
TV9 and V6 rank 2nd and 3rd with 83 GRP. T News has clocked 74 GRP.
In the combined Telugu states, NTV is continuing to lead the charts in the Telugu states with 63 GRP for the 18th week of 2023. ABN has 26 GRP.
Interestingly, Sakshi, a mouthpiece of the ruling party of Andhra Pradesh, has just 11 GRP which is shockingly low, and might also depict the current public trends in the state.
